Sony Ericsson in big trouble: net profit 97% under, cuts down 2000 jobs

Fri, Jul 18, 2008

News

Sony EricssonIn lack of a better expression to describe the delicate situation, Sony Ericsson is in very deep shit. Why? Just look at the numbers. Net profits for the telecommunications giant ended up falling through the floor to the tune of 97% in Q2!

Indeed, a delicate situation. Things were looking bad even from the start of the year, when they reported terrible numbers for the first quarter, but no one could possible foresee anything like this. The main problem was that concerning the mid-to-high-end mobiles sales, making the biggest proportion of the deficit. SE has a lots of hopes in stored in the new Xperia X1, just recently released, but nothing can really help them at this point. The company will be forced to fire 2000 employees from around the globe, although no details concerning the actual location of the cut offs were made public.

Hopefully the situation doesn’t escalate too long, from here on, otherwise the company might face dire times…
